Realizar un formulario en html puede parecer la cosa mas sencilla que nos puedan pedir. Pero muchas no tenemos a disposición un base para poder comenzar.
Me he dado la tarea de realizar un pequeño formulario que poco a poco iré desarrollando, aplicandole color y efectos con CSS - Javascript. Tambien iré probando jugar con PHP + MySql y por ultimo jugar con la API de Facebook.
El código básico de un formulario en html seria:
<form action="">
<label for="Nombre">Nombre y Apellido</label>
<input type="text" id="nombre" name="nombre" placeholder="Nombre y Apellidos" required>
<label for="email">Correo Electrónico</label>
<input type="email" id="email" name="email" placeholder="Escriba su correo electrónico" required>
<label for="telefono">Teléfono</label>
<input type="tel" id="telefono" name="telefono" placeholder="Escriba su telefono movil" required>
<label for="mensaje">Escriba un mensaje</label>
<input type="textarea" id="mensaje" name="mensaje">
<input type="submit" value="E n v i a r">
</form>
Aspectos en común:- Id =””: Este atributo nos sirve para diferenciar cada una de las etiquetas input en nuestro CSS, también puede “class”.
- Name=””: Cuando empece a trabajar, no entendia para que carajos la usaban. No fue hasta que empece a trabajar con PHP y MySql. El atributo “name” nos permite diferenciar cada uno de los campos del formulario e identificarlos para poder guardarlo en una base de datos. Es importante que este no este repetido con los demás campos
- Placeholder=””: Me parece un atributo muy, pero muy útil. Con este podemos guiar a nuestros visitante lo que tienen que introducir en ese campo, aunque parezca ridículo, siempre es bueno recordarles que tienen que introducir su nombre y apellido en el campo “Nombre y Apellido”.
- Required=””: Existe información que necesitamos si o si de aquellos que quieren contactarse con nosotros. En este ejemplo creo que todos son necesarios para comunicarnos con ellos, pero hay formularios en el que introducir algunos datos personales es opcional
- Value=””: Se lo utiliza mas para los de tipo “submit” que vendrían a ser el botón de enviar. Pero también sirve para darle algunos valores por defecto a los campos que tenemos arriba, como también los valores de la etiqueta “select”.
Tipos de input:
- Text:
- Email:
- Tel:
- Textarea
- Submit
(Creo que no es necesario explicar cada uno de ellos, pues su mismo nombre nos da una idea para qué es lo que sirve).
Eso todo lo que deberías saber (por ahora) acerca de los formularios html. Poco a poco iré publicando algunos de las características y problemas con las que me topado a la hora de realizar cumplir algunos caprichos de diferentes empresas.

SOCIALIZALO →